What is a key element to include in an Equipment User's Guide?

A key element to include in an Equipment User's Guide is the inclusion of operating instructions and maintenance information. This aspect is vital as it directly impacts the safe and efficient use of the equipment. Operating instructions provide users with the necessary steps to correctly operate the equipment, ensuring that they understand how to use it effectively and safely. Maintenance information guides users on how to keep the equipment in optimal working condition, promoting longevity and performance. Without these critical pieces of information, users may struggle to operate the equipment properly or neglect necessary maintenance, both of which could lead to inefficiencies or accidents.

In contrast, while a historical background of the equipment may offer context, it does not enhance the user's immediate ability to operate or maintain the equipment. Similarly, while knowing about available spare parts is useful, it is not as crucial as knowing how to operate and care for the equipment itself. Personal anecdotes, while they can be interesting, do not serve a formal instructional purpose. Thus, the focus on operating instructions and maintenance information stands as the most essential element in an Equipment User's Guide.
